Gone Girl by Gillian Flynn
This was another book I heard about via Twitter and again, I was not disappointed. I follow some smart people. It is hard to explain the plot without giving anything away, so I will just tell you it is about a couple who moved away from New York then the wife goes missing and the husband becomes suspect #1. Your jaw will be on the floor the whole time! I promise. There are twists and turns crazier than Britney Spears.
I actually hope they make this into a movie.

Ru by Kim Thuy
I found a recommendation for this book on Twitter and hope to inspire someone else to read it.
It follows a Vietnamese child of war to Canada and to a successful life. Though short and continuously jumping between times and countries it is all beautifully tied together and touches on a lot of things — race, culture, history, war, etc etc etc. Through this style of writing you are forced to think and reflect on the reading which is the point, no?
